waggonette
English
    
    
Noun
    
waggonette (plural waggonettes)
- Alternative form of wagonette
- 1914, Thomas Hardy, 'At Castle Boterel' in Satires of Circumstance, Macmillan, page 121:
- As I drive to the junction of lane and high-way,
 - And the drizzle bedrenches the waggonette,
 - I look behind at the fading byway
